Transaction 40c236843b6ab7028adda44131f2ca915484a717f7755add279b2c122d3fdb78
1 Input
1 Output
-
40c236843b6ab7028adda44131f2ca915484a717f7755add279b2c122d3fdb78:0
- value
- 15434004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d5cfbf9458fa44e840b8e848897f71bdffaa46b OP_EQUAL
- address
- 3MsUebgZ5osRBkZdKYKAhgoSxNygGNbaMs